Megvii Engine Team
05186e7bd9
fix(midout): fix elemwise crash after midout
some dnn backends opr will use agency opr,
for example: softmax cpu naive imp will call elemwise opr,
at model dump stage, we can not get dnn runtime logic,
so we record elemwise mode info at runtime stage.
GitOrigin-RevId: 6528b4c85d
3 years ago
Megvii Engine Team
9be8de6025
fix(midout): formatting midout tools
GitOrigin-RevId: 9aa6a9ec57
3 years ago
Megvii Engine Team
8182af6eb6
fix(mgb): fix strategy of grad_op and opr_attr
GitOrigin-RevId: bb7ab8fa9d
3 years ago
Megvii Engine Team
70209667e8
fix(dnn/test): fix some bug when force_deduce_layout is off
GitOrigin-RevId: d7ccc397df
3 years ago
Megvii Engine Team
597a1e791b
refactor(imperative): add interface to clear algorithm cache
GitOrigin-RevId: 662618954b
3 years ago
Megvii Engine Team
e2f5156b69
refactor(megbrain): save fastrun result to algorithm cache
GitOrigin-RevId: 45301ebb4d
3 years ago
Megvii Engine Team
f902ba2433
docs(megbrain): add notes for fastrun
GitOrigin-RevId: b59f7f205d
3 years ago
Megvii Engine Team
d968942fe3
perf(cuda): speedup direct large kernel conv
GitOrigin-RevId: 3ff6a9caeb
3 years ago
Qsingle
b4f9703f48
fix(overflow): fix the overflow of the long_scalars in network_node and module_stats
3 years ago
Megvii Engine Team
b2cffdde3e
fix(lite): fix lite cpu default not work
GitOrigin-RevId: 8fc764623c
3 years ago
Megvii Engine Team
dbce6526d6
fix(mge/functional): fix return dtype of comparison function
GitOrigin-RevId: 810e32a829
3 years ago
Megvii Engine Team
7dc347697a
feat(dnn/cuda): add typecvt uint16
GitOrigin-RevId: d1368c414e
3 years ago
Megvii Engine Team
b92866d2c2
fix(build): fix build depends dirty file issue
GitOrigin-RevId: 435d8b5c50
3 years ago
megvii-mge
9d8983f323
Merge pull request #457 from kagome1007/updatenewlogo
fix(mge): update logo
3 years ago
“wenjuan”
e3f591cadf
fix(mge): update logo
3 years ago
Megvii Engine Team
4b27e861f4
fix(ops): implement from_op_node for reshape
GitOrigin-RevId: 4c99438504
3 years ago
Megvii Engine Team
4fb3d886b8
perf(misc): use reinterpret_cast to convert valueshape
GitOrigin-RevId: ee14c7ce5e
3 years ago
Megvii Engine Team
951ed476d6
fix(minigraph): supports varnode forwarding
GitOrigin-RevId: 4494106f0a
3 years ago
Megvii Engine Team
27d4c4b36c
refactor(stats): use static inline variable declaration
GitOrigin-RevId: 7d86e5f257
3 years ago
Megvii Engine Team
787a22a9d6
perf(tensor): implement __new__ in cpp
GitOrigin-RevId: 4defd249c3
3 years ago
Megvii Engine Team
99df4a7996
fix(dtype): dtype scalar set_retain_dtype supports bool
GitOrigin-RevId: aafd378e1b
3 years ago
Megvii Engine Team
53d48ca399
fix(fastrun): persistent cache add prefix
(cherry picked from commit bdd82c1976
)
GitOrigin-RevId: 0b13d32175
3 years ago
Megvii Engine Team
7005b7d691
fix(mge): fix fastpath check
GitOrigin-RevId: acc8957469
3 years ago
Megvii Engine Team
7bf5b0ee1e
test(imperative): check env values after each pytest
GitOrigin-RevId: 826788113a
3 years ago
Megvii Engine Team
811579b0e7
fix(imperative): restrict value converts to symbolvar
GitOrigin-RevId: 271267be69
3 years ago
Megvii Engine Team
b3f79966fd
fix(mgb): fix "TRT_ERROR: INVALID_ARGUMENT: Get binding data type failed."
GitOrigin-RevId: d9601cb15b
3 years ago
Megvii Engine Team
99a85c4079
fix(mge): fix advanced indexing grad
GitOrigin-RevId: 8033c9322d
3 years ago
Megvii Engine Team
409c988163
fix(imperative): add matmul apply_on_varnode
GitOrigin-RevId: 2cf6bf237c
3 years ago
Megvii Engine Team
d52ba79d89
fix(lite): support set data by copy on device tensor
GitOrigin-RevId: 88b7f73d36
3 years ago
Megvii Engine Team
275f12c98a
fix(mge): fix dimshuffle shape infer
GitOrigin-RevId: ad7a73fbd1
3 years ago
Megvii Engine Team
e59b6e13a3
fix(imperative/src): fix empty_tensor bug of convbwd&rng
GitOrigin-RevId: 4c948f41f0
3 years ago
Megvii Engine Team
115c4592c0
fix(dnn/opencl): fix opencl elemwise tuning issue
GitOrigin-RevId: 317640547d
3 years ago
Megvii Engine Team
b9cbc10120
feat(lite): add pack model
GitOrigin-RevId: 1a150f2af3
3 years ago
Megvii Engine Team
7927e98fd6
perf(mge): speed up PixelShuffle
GitOrigin-RevId: 942e755745
3 years ago
Megvii Engine Team
43e5f41c4b
docs(mgb/docs): add alternative interface for deprecated api
GitOrigin-RevId: fdeaa5b64f
3 years ago
Megvii Engine Team
ba90a02834
feat(mge): opt third_party prepare 2/2
GitOrigin-RevId: fe38868906
3 years ago
Megvii Engine Team
ff9e612152
fix(lite): fix lar LITE_WITH_CUDA and LITE_WITH_OPENCL invalid for bazel
GitOrigin-RevId: c10bb0fbe1
3 years ago
Megvii Engine Team
73112558d0
feat(mge/dnn): support checknonfinite for fp16
GitOrigin-RevId: 83fa139ac0
3 years ago
Megvii Engine Team
f7e10ea8d7
perf(imperative): improve matmul/batch_matmul
GitOrigin-RevId: 4ceb2eb601
3 years ago
Megvii Engine Team
1c2a323e78
feat(mge): add warning message when mismatched cuda sm is detected
GitOrigin-RevId: f78c79eb06
3 years ago
Megvii Engine Team
877bda4180
perf(mge): improve cross stream memory borrowing
GitOrigin-RevId: c68977c5dc
3 years ago
Megvii Engine Team
ed7fa10470
feat(fallback): move direct multi_thread_common helper to fallback
GitOrigin-RevId: 27ed93e4c1
3 years ago
Megvii Engine Team
8871ad74af
refactor(fallback): opt gi naive reinterpret
GitOrigin-RevId: d27c6bccfe
3 years ago
Megvii Engine Team
c2eec47b42
fix(imperative/src): fix adaptive_pooling bug
GitOrigin-RevId: e1dc46e3fa
3 years ago
Megvii Engine Team
ffbf8fad6c
feat(fallback): add general intrinsic to elemwise multitype
GitOrigin-RevId: fe7b335545
3 years ago
Megvii Engine Team
484e1f1173
fix(build): fix riscv64 gcc build with > O0
GitOrigin-RevId: 9ad3480492
3 years ago
Megvii Engine Team
14e9ad625d
fix(megdnn): emit define-but-not-referenced and extra-;-ignored warning on cuda9.0~cuda9.1
GitOrigin-RevId: f6db42e395
3 years ago
Megvii Engine Team
4c0bff1dba
refactor(megdnn): refactor TEGRA_X1/X2 macro
GitOrigin-RevId: 1aa78712c6
3 years ago
Megvii Engine Team
758549b936
feat(megengine): support tx2
GitOrigin-RevId: d1175a1f4a
3 years ago
Megvii Engine Team
84ce94fbd9
docs(imperative): fix docs about vision related function
GitOrigin-RevId: 55d12d5e7a
3 years ago